Joseph Loffredo Obituary

Joseph C. Loffredo, 89 of Lake George and Niskayuna passed away peacefully Thursday, March 3, 2022 at the Pines of Glens Falls. Born on June 5, 1932 in Schenectady he was the oldest son of the late Carmine J. Loffredo and Lucie Cerasuola Loffredo. Joseph was a faithful communicant of Sacred Heart Church in Lake George. He was a graduate of Nott Terrace High School in Schenectady, Union College where he played baseball, and Albany Medical College.

He completed his residency in Pediatrics at Albany Medical Center. Joe spent two years at 6oth Station Army Hospital in Chinon, France. At this time, he and his wife Eileen enjoyed visiting special places in Europe.

Upon returning from France in 1963 he and his wife settled in Schenectady. Joe and his brother Dr. Albert Loffredo practiced pediatrics for thirty-two years. During this time Joe became Chief of Pediatrics at Ellis Hospital. In the years that followed Joe and Eileen retired to Lake George and spent the Winter months in Florida.

Joe was an avid sports fan and spent many summer evenings watching his favorite baseball team the New York Yankees. Joe also enjoyed thoroughbred racing, fishing in Lake George, and gardening.
